Arrests Made in Connection to Toddler’s Shooting in Langley Park

In a shocking turn of events, arrests have been made in connection to the tragic shooting and killing of a toddler in Langley Park. This devastating incident has left the community in mourning, but the recent developments in the case offer a glimmer of hope for justice.

Breaking the news on Twitter, Katie Lusso (@KatieLusso) announced the arrests, shedding light on a potential breakthrough in the investigation. The authorities have been working tirelessly to apprehend those responsible for this senseless act of violence, and it seems their efforts have finally paid off.

Details surrounding the arrests are limited at this time, but it is believed that multiple individuals have been taken into custody. The investigation is ongoing, and law enforcement agencies are working diligently to gather evidence and ensure a thorough prosecution.
